MARRIOTT HOTELS CELEBRATE ONE YEAR IN SRI LANKA

Weligama Bay Marriott Resort and Spa, an iconic brand of Marriott International, celebrated its first anniversary on July 20.

Within just one year since its opening, the resort is one of the most sought after hotels among local and foreign travelers. The property offers 198 beautifully-designed expansive rooms and suites, right in the heart of Weligama Bay - a charming seaside fishing village famous for surfing.

Each unit of accommodation offers a King or Twin bed configuration, separate bath and shower, a 55 inch television, Wi-Fi and a balcony. The resort boasts of not just one, but three outdoor swimming pools, overlooking vistas of the seaside.

The property caters to families with young children with a large, interactive indoor kid’s activity center with fun-filled game zones and play areas. Adults are offered the resort’s renowned Quan Spa which offers authentic Thai and Swedish therapies and a well-equipped fitness center.

The all-day dining restaurant, ‘Weligama Kitchen’, spreads across different zones while ‘The Big Fish’ is a chef driven restaurant offering gourmet seafood. ‘Mirissa Baking Company’ provides freshly-baked desserts and snacks, accompanied by a selection of fine coffee, fresh juices and specialty drinks and there is also ‘Surf’s Up’ the pool bar.
